Webb23 feb. 2024 · The water molecule is not linear but bent in a special way. The two hydrogen atoms are bound to the oxygen atom at an angle of 104.5°. The O―H distance ( bond length) is 95.7 picometres (9.57 × 10 −11 metres, or 3.77 × 10 −9 inches).
